I went down to the listening event at Highbury today below is a conversation with staff on Rowan 1:

We struggle with staff sickness and people leaving so we can't give time that we would like to. However, the team works well together.
The main issue we have is the staffing. We get good feedback from patients and verbally we get a lot of feedback from carers or even cards syaing thank you.
We try really hard to do recovery focussed work, but as we struggle with staff levels it's really difficult to organise this. Staff are human at the end of the day and we try to avoid the 'them and us' mentality.
Staffing is something out of the wards control and a lack of staff has made it quite dangerous. If there’s an incident and you are relying on support from other wards, if they’re short staffed too, it’s not safe.
